On 11/21/2006, Rajesh Tiwari wrote:
> Thanks Dave, but I was looking for any patches for this issue. regards, 
> Rajesh

In that case, you may want to review the cygwin-patches list, cvs logs,
changelogs, or even the release announcements.  All of these should provide
some insight, though the release announcements and/or changelogs would
probably provide the info at the level that you'd most likely be able to
easily relate it to your problem.  That's, of course, no guarantee that
you can apply it to some older local build that you might want to patch.
But it would be a start for doing such an evaluation.  Of course, it's
likely to be quicker and easier just to upgrade, if you have the option.
